1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the formula for the area of a parallelogram?
Back
Area = base × height
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do you calculate the volume of a prism?
Back
Volume = base area × height
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the formula for the area of a trapezoid?
Back
A = 1/2 (base1 + base2) × height
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the volume of a rectangular prism with length 5 cm, width 3 cm, and height 2 cm?
Back
Volume = 5 × 3 × 2 = 30 cm³
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the area of a rectangle with length 10 ft and width 7 ft?
Back
Area = 10 × 7 = 70 ft²
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the formula for the area of a triangle?
Back
Area = 1/2 × base × height
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do you find the height of a trapezoid if you know the area and the lengths of the bases?
Back
Height = (2 × Area) / (base1 + base2)
